Committee to quiz Scottish and UK Governments on Glasgow’s Safer Drug Consumption Facility
The Scottish Affairs Committee will question the Minister for Policing and Crime, Dame Diana Johnson, and Scotland’s Health Secretary, Neil Gray, in the final session of the committee’s inquiry into Glasgow’s Safer Drug Consumption Facility (SDCF).
Meeting details
In the first panel, the cross-party committee will question Neil Gray, Cabinet Secretary for Health and Social Care for the Scottish Government. MPs may ask about the role the Scottish Government played in the opening of the facility, also known as the Thistle, the legal risks it faces and potential exemptions which could be needed if the service were to expand. Members could also discuss whether more facilities are needed across Scotland and the future of its funding.
In the second panel, Members will quiz Dame Diana Johnson, the UK Government’s Crime, Policing and Fire Minister. Questions could explore the UK Government’s position on the pilot SDCF, what role the UK Government could have in its operation and the potential for more facilities.
